反向打印文件内容命令

MySQLMySQLBeginner
立即练习

💡 本教程由 AI 辅助翻译自英文原版。如需查看原文,您可以 切换至英文原版

简介

在本项目中,你将学习如何在 MySQL 客户端中使用 SQL 语句反向打印 Linux 终端命令。本项目旨在帮助你理解 SQL 的基础知识,以及如何使用它对文本数据执行简单操作。

👀 预览

未完成项目的预览

🎯 任务

在本项目中,你将学习:

  • 如何使用sudo命令无密码访问 MySQL 数据库
  • 如何编写 SQL 语句来反向执行cat命令
  • 如何将 SQL 语句保存到文件中
  • 如何在 MySQL 客户端中运行 SQL 脚本

🏆 成果

完成本项目后,你将能够:

  • 理解如何使用 SQL 语句操作文本数据
  • 学习如何在 MySQL 客户端中保存和执行 SQL 脚本
  • 获得使用 MySQL 客户端和执行基本数据库操作的经验

Skills Graph

%%%%{init: {'theme':'neutral'}}%%%% flowchart RL mysql(("MySQL")) -.-> mysql/BasicKeywordsandStatementsGroup(["Basic Keywords and Statements"]) mysql(("MySQL")) -.-> mysql/DatabaseFunctionsandDataTypesGroup(["Database Functions and Data Types"]) mysql(("MySQL")) -.-> mysql/SystemManagementToolsGroup(["System Management Tools"]) mysql/BasicKeywordsandStatementsGroup -.-> mysql/use_database("Database Selection") mysql/BasicKeywordsandStatementsGroup -.-> mysql/select("Data Retrieval") mysql/BasicKeywordsandStatementsGroup -.-> mysql/source("External Code Execution") mysql/DatabaseFunctionsandDataTypesGroup -.-> mysql/user("User Info Function") mysql/SystemManagementToolsGroup -.-> mysql/mysqladmin("Admin Utility") subgraph Lab Skills mysql/use_database -.-> lab-301402{{"反向打印文件内容命令"}} mysql/select -.-> lab-301402{{"反向打印文件内容命令"}} mysql/source -.-> lab-301402{{"反向打印文件内容命令"}} mysql/user -.-> lab-301402{{"反向打印文件内容命令"}} mysql/mysqladmin -.-> lab-301402{{"反向打印文件内容命令"}} end

无密码访问 MySQL

在本步骤中,你将学习如何使用sudo命令无密码访问 MySQL 数据库。

  1. 在你的 Linux 系统上打开一个终端。
  2. 通过运行以下命令启动 MySQL 服务:
sudo service mysql start
  1. 通过运行以下命令访问 MySQL 客户端:
sudo mysql

这样你就可以无密码访问 MySQL 数据库了。

反向打印“Cat”命令

在本步骤中,你将学习如何编写一条 SQL 语句,以便在 Linux 终端中反向打印cat命令。

  1. 在 MySQL 客户端中,运行以下 SQL 语句:

    SELECT REVERSE('cat');

    这将反转字符串'cat'并显示输出'tac'

  2. 在 MySQL 客户端中,运行以下命令将 SQL 语句保存到文件:

    SELECT REVERSE('cat');

    这将在/home/labex/project目录中创建reverseCat.sql文件,并将 SQL 语句保存到该文件中。

运行 SQL 脚本

在本步骤中,你将学习如何在 MySQL 客户端中运行reverseCat.sql脚本。

  1. 在 MySQL 客户端中,运行以下命令来执行脚本:

    SOURCE /home/labex/project/reverseCat.sql;

    这将执行reverseCat.sql文件中的 SQL 语句,并显示输出'tac'

恭喜你!你已完成该项目。你应该会看到以下输出:

MariaDB [(none)]> SOURCE /home/labex/project/reverseCat.sql;
+----------------+
| REVERSE('cat') |
+----------------+
| tac            |
+----------------+
1 row in set (0.000 sec)
✨ 查看解决方案并练习

总结

恭喜你!你已完成本项目。你可以在 LabEx 中练习更多实验来提升你的技能。